Who We Are Hello There! We’re Speech & Language Link (you might have heard of us before, especially if you come from an educational background ;)). We support over 4,000 UK schools as they deliver over 230,000 speech and language assessments annually and then use our interventions and resources with identified children. Our standardised assessments and innovative evidence-based interventions are designed for students aged 3 to 14 years and have won multiple awards. We enjoy an informal working environment, with our offices on the pleasant University of Kent campus in Canterbury. We respect the work-life balance of our staff and are a family friendly company.
